House roof installation services involve replacing an existing roof or installing a new roof on a property. This process typically includes removing the old roofing materials, inspecting the underlying structure, and then carefully installing new shingles, tiles, or other roofing materials. Skilled contractors ensure that the new roof is properly sealed and secured to provide long-lasting protection against weather elements. Homeowners seeking a roof installation might be upgrading an aging roof, building a new home, or replacing a damaged roof to improve the overall safety and appearance of their property.
Roof installation services help address common issues such as leaks, water damage, and structural deterioration. Over time, exposure to rain, snow, wind, and sun can weaken roofing materials, leading to cracks, missing shingles, or rotting wood. A new roof can effectively eliminate persistent leaks, prevent further water intrusion, and restore the integrity of the structure. This service is also useful for correcting problems caused by poor installation or inferior materials used in previous roofing work, helping homeowners avoid costly repairs down the line.

The overview below groups typical House Roof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- minor roof repairs such as replacing shingles or fixing leaks typically cost between $250 and $600. Many routine maintenance jobs fall within this range, depending on the extent of the damage and materials used.
Partial Roof Replacement - replacing a section of a roof or repairing specific areas generally ranges from $1,000 to $3,500. Most projects in this category are moderate in size and complexity, with fewer reaching the higher end of the spectrum.
Full Roof Replacement - a complete roof replacement for an average-sized home can cost between $5,000 and $12,000. Larger or more complex projects, such as those with specialty materials, can exceed $15,000, but many projects fall into the mid-range.
Complex or Custom Projects - specialized installations or roofs with unique features may range from $15,000 to $30,000 or more. These projects are less common and often involve custom materials or design elements that increase costs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When comparing local contractors for house roof installation, it’s important to consider their experience with similar projects. Homeowners should look for service providers who have a proven track record of completing roof installations comparable in size and style to the one needed. An experienced contractor will be familiar with common challenges and best practices, which can contribute to a smoother process and a more durable result. Asking for examples of past work or references related to similar projects can provide insight into their familiarity with the type of roof being installed.
Clear, written expectations are essential when evaluating potential service providers. Homeowners should seek contractors who can provide detailed proposals outlining the scope of work, materials to be used, and any warranties or guarantees offered. Having this information in writing helps ensure that everyone is aligned on project details and reduces the potential for misunderstandings. It’s also beneficial to clarify the timeline and responsibilities upfront, so expectations are transparent from the start.
Good communication and reputable references are key indicators of a reliable contractor. Service providers who are responsive, transparent, and willing to answer questions demonstrate professionalism and a commitment to customer satisfaction. Checking references or reviews can reveal how previous clients experienced working with the contractor, including their reliability and quality of work.
